阅读量:2
保障Spring与MySQL的安全性是一个综合性的任务,涉及到多个方面的措施。以下是一些关键的安全保障措施:
Spring框架安全性
- 身份验证和授权:使用Spring Security框架来管理用户身份验证和授权,确保只有合法用户可以访问应用程序的敏感部分。
- 数据加密:对敏感数据进行加密存储和传输,以保护用户数据不被未授权访问。
- 安全配置:配置Spring Security以限制对特定端点的访问,例如,只允许管理员访问管理界面。
- 日志和监控:启用日志记录和监控,以便及时发现和响应安全事件。
MySQL数据库安全性
- 最小权限原则:为数据库用户分配最小的必要权限,避免使用root用户进行日常操作。
- 强密码策略:设置强密码,并定期更新,以防止暴力破解。
- 加密通信:使用SSL/TLS加密通信,保护数据在传输过程中的安全。
- 备份和恢复:定期备份数据库,并测试恢复流程,确保在发生安全事件时能够快速恢复。
综合安全措施
- 定期更新和打补丁:保持Spring和MySQL的最新状态,及时应用安全补丁。
- 安全审计:定期进行安全审计,识别和修复潜在的安全漏洞。
- 教育和培训:对开发者和数据库管理员进行安全意识培训,提高他们对安全最佳实践的认识。
通过实施上述措施,可以显著提高Spring应用程序与MySQL数据库的整体安全性,保护应用程序和用户数据免受威胁。
以上就是关于“Spring与MySQL的安全性如何保障”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m